Mrs. Green talks with Kathy Jacobs, Director for the Center for Climate Adaptation, Science, and Solutions at The University of Arizona and an internationally known and well respected expert on water. In Part 2 Kathy offers hope for the future of our water and solutions that we can all be a part of. Lots of information packed into this 3-minute episode!

Recorded and produced by Amanda Shauger.
